أفضل 5 برامج لكتابة الأكواد البرمجية لسنة 2023
كل مبرمج أو متعلم في مجال البرمجة يحتاج إلى تطبيق يساعده على كتابة الأكواد بسرعة وكفاءة مما يوفر عليه الوقت والجهد.وهذا دفعهم إلى البحث عن أدوات مختلفة لهذا الغرض. ومع ذلك، في مواجهة الكثير من البرامج المتاحة لكتابة التعليمات البرمجية، اكتشفوا أن هناك اختلافات كبيرة فيما بينها. لذا، سنعرض لك في هذه المقالة أربعة من أفضل البرامج التي يمكنك استخدامها لكتابة التعليمات البرمجية بكفاءة.
أفضل 5 برامج لكتابة التعليمات البرمجية
1. المفكرة ++ Notepad++
يعد برنامج Notepad++ أحد أشهر البرامج لكتابة التعليمات البرمجية. يمكن للمحترفين استخدامه بسهولة لكتابة الأكواد بلغات البرمجة المختلفة. ويتميز بالقدرة على تمييز رموز الألوان المختلفة لسهولة القراءة والبحث. كما يوفر أيضًا وظيفة بحث واستبدال بسيطة. بالإضافة إلى ذلك، فإن واجهته سهلة الاستخدام، ومجانية تمامًا، ولا تؤثر بشكل كبير على أداء الكمبيوتر.
يحتوي برنامج Notepad++ على العديد من الميزات المفيدة، بما في ذلك:
- تمييز الصيغة: يتيح لك تمييز الصيغة تمييز عناصر مختلفة في ملف نصي مثل الكلمات الأساسية وأسماء المتغيرات والمعرفات.
- طي النص: يسمح لك طي النص بإخفاء أجزاء من التعليمات البرمجية التي لا تحتاج إلى رؤيتها.
- الإكمال التلقائي: يُكمل الإكمال التلقائي الكلمة أو العبارة التي تبدأ كتابتها تلقائيًا.
- البحث والاستبدال: يتيح لك البحث والاستبدال البحث عن نص واستبداله بنص آخر.
- السجل: يسجل السجل كل تغيير تقوم به على الملف.
- التراجع والإعادة: يتيح لك التراجع والإعادة التراجع عن آخر التغييرات التي أجريتها.
- ترجمة: يتيح لك ترجمة النص من لغة إلى أخرى.
- الوحدات: تسمح لك الوحدات بإضافة وظائف إضافية إلى برنامج Notepad++.
2. Sublime Text 3
يعد Sublime Text 3 أحد أفضل البرامج التي يستخدمها المبرمجون. يحتوي على واجهة بسيطة ولكنها أنيقة ويقدم الكثير من الميزات. ومن أهم هذه الميزات ميزة الإكمال التلقائي التي توفر الكثير من الوقت وتزيد الإنتاجية. وهو يدعم لغات برمجة متعددة ويأتي في نسخة مجانية تماما.
يحتوي Sublime Text 3 على العديد من الميزات المفيدة، بما في ذلك:
دعم اللغة: يدعم Sublime Text 3 تسليط الضوء على بناء الجملة لأكثر من 100 لغة برمجة، بما في ذلك C وC++ وJava وPython وJavaScript وPHP وHTML وCSS.
- الإكمال التلقائي: يدعم الإكمال التلقائي لأنواع مختلفة من العناصر، مثل الكلمات الرئيسية وأسماء المتغيرات والمعرفات.
- طي النص: يدعم طي النص لإخفاء أجزاء من التعليمات البرمجية التي لا تحتاج إلى رؤيتها.
- التنقل السريع: استخدم اختصارات لوحة المفاتيح للتنقل بسرعة إلى أي مكان في ملف أو مشروع.
- البحث والاستبدال: يدعم البحث والاستبدال باستخدام الأنماط المعقدة.
- الوحدات: تسمح لك الوحدات بإضافة وظائف إضافية إلى Sublime Text 3، مثل دعم لغات البرمجة الإضافية أو أدوات التطوير.
- الأداء: يوفر Sublime Text 3 أداءً سريعًا وسلسًا.
3. Brackets
يعد Brackets برنامجًا مفضلاً بين مصممي ومطوري الويب لأنه مصمم خصيصًا للعمل مع لغات برمجة الويب مثل HTML وCSS وJavaScript. يحتوي على العديد من الميزات التي تجعل من السهل استخدامه كأداة لتطوير مواقع الويب وتوفير الوقت. كما يسمح للمستخدمين بتخصيصه عن طريق إضافة الملحقات.
4. المنارة Light Table
Light Table هو مشروع تمويل جماعي ناجح للغاية. وميزته أنه يمكنه عرض نتائج التعليمات البرمجية المكتوبة مباشرة دون الحاجة إلى حفظ المشروع، مما يجعله فريدا بين البرامج الأخرى. كما يحتوي على العديد من الإضافات الهامة للمبرمجين.
5. كود فيجوال ستوديو Visual Studio
VS Code (Visual Studio Code) هي بيئة تطوير مفتوحة المصدر متعددة الأغراض تم تطويرها بواسطة Microsoft. تعد VS Code إحدى الأدوات الأكثر شهرة وشعبية في مجال تطوير البرمجيات بسبب مجموعة الميزات المتقدمة التي تقدمها.
يرجى اتباع ارشادات المحتوى عند كتابه التعليق